In addition, an American living and working outside the usa (expat) may exclude from taxable income the income earned from work outside the country. This exclusion is by two parts. The basic exclusion has limitations to USD 95,100 for your 2012 tax year, and in addition USD 97,600 for the 2013 tax year. These amounts are determined on a daily pro rata cause of all days on the fact that the expat qualifies for the exclusion. In addition, the expat may exclude heap he or she taken care of housing in the foreign country in excess of 16% among the basic exclusion. This housing exclusion is restricted by jurisdiction. For 2012, the housing exclusion could be the amount paid in overabundance of USD 41.57 per day. For 2013, the amounts more than USD 44.78 per day may be excluded.
